Examining the dark nexus between genocide and state power, this investigation reveals how those responsible for mass atrocities often evade justice and profit from their crimes. Christopher Simpson uncovers CIA chief Allen Dulles' role in facilitating the escape of high-ranking Nazis post-World War II, highlighting the complicity of U.S. officials in enabling war criminals. The narrative traces the historical roots of mass murder, from the Armenian genocide to the Holocaust, and critiques how international law can inadvertently support such atrocities.
